The most-watched game of the Women’s College World Series outdrew the most-watched men’s game by a small amount this year.

Oklahoma’s title-clinching win against Texas drew a peak of 2.1 million viewers and an average of 1.74 million viewers. In comparison, the most-watched men’s game — Saturday’s championship series Game 1 between Ole Miss and Oklahoma — drew a peak of 1.9 million and an average of 1.63 million viewers.

That number makes Oklahoma’s championship win the most-watched college softball or baseball game of 2022.

The averages for the baseball and softball championship series were similar, with the women drawing an average of 1.7 million viewers across the series and the men drawing 1.6 million.

The men’s championship series closed out the most-watched NCAA baseball tournament in four years.

The overall viewership for the softball tournament was down slightly from last year. This year’s tournament – while having a higher ceiling – averaged 1 million viewers compared to 1.2 million last year.
